Freddie Legrand Greer's Obituary
Funeral services for Freddie Legrand Greer, 80, of Hallsville, will be 2 PM Wednesday, September 24, 2003 in the Chapel of Rader Funeral Home with Reverend David Massey and Reverend John Taylor officiating.
Interment will follow in Hallsville Cemetery.
Mr. Greer was born September 25, 1922 in Wood County, Texas to
Dyess and Alice Greer. He was a lifelong resident of the Hallsville area, a member and Deacon of the Hallsville First Baptist Church, and was a maintenance supervisor for the Texas Eastman Company from where he retired after 26 years of service.
He had attended Hallsville schools, took classes at Kilgore College and attended East Texas Baptist University in Marshall. He also taught a Sunday School class at First Baptist Church in Hallsville and served his country
in the United States Army during World War II.
The family will receive friends at the funeral home Tuesday evening from 6-8 PM.
Pallbearers for Mr. Greer will be the Sunday School Class.
The family has asked that memorials be made to the First Baptist Church Building Fund.
Mr. Greer is survived by his wife, Pauline Walls Greer of Hallsville;
sons and daughters-in-law, Johnny Carroll and Sandra Greer of Rhode Island, David Allen and Debra Greer of Hallsville, TX; grandchildren, Wendy Greer Frances and Randy Greer of Rhode Island, Chelsey Greer and Spencer Greer;
brothers, Rudolph Greer, Finis Greer, Robert Greer, all of Harrison Co.; sister, Ruthdale Sandlen of Mesquite, TX; step grandchildren, Bud Perkins and of Hallsville; and three step great grandchildren.
Fred loved his family, friends and church.
